选择云服务器带宽是否“够用”,不能只看峰值或经验值,而需结合业务场景、用户行为、技术架构和成本效益综合判断。以下是系统化的选型指南:
一、影响带宽选择的关键因素(按重要性排序):
✅ 1. 业务类型与流量模型(决定性因素)
-
静态内容分发(官网、图片站、下载站):
→ 带宽需求 ≈ 并发用户数 × 平均单用户请求大小 ÷ 页面加载时间
示例:1000并发用户,平均页面3MB(含图片/JS/CSS),5秒内加载完 → 理论峰值带宽 ≈ (1000 × 3MB) / 5s = 600 MB/s ≈ 4800 Mbps(注意单位换算:1MB/s = 8Mbps)
✅ 实际需叠加20–50%冗余,并考虑CDN缓存后回源流量仅占5–20%。 -
动态Web/API服务(电商、后台系统):
→ 关键是请求频次+响应体大小+连接保持,带宽压力通常远低于静态站。
例如:100 QPS,平均API响应2KB → 带宽 ≈ 100 × 2KB × 8 = 1.6 Mbps(极低),但需关注连接数、延迟和后端数据库压力。 -
音视频直播/点播:
→ 按码率 × 并发观众数计算,且必须区分上行(推流) 和 下行(拉流)。
4K直播(6Mbps/路)× 5000观众 = 30Gbps下行 → 必须用CDN+边缘节点,单台云服务器无法承载。 -
游戏服务器(MMO/实时对战):
→ 带宽敏感度低,更关注网络延迟、抖动、连接数;典型TCP长连接,单用户仅2–10Kbps,但需高并发连接支持(如10万连接)。
✅ 2. 用户地域分布与访问模式
- 若用户集中在国内,可选BGP多线带宽;若全球用户,需结合CDN + 海外节点,避免单点带宽瓶颈。
- 是否存在流量潮汐现象?(如教育平台晚8点高峰、电商大促零点爆发)→ 需按95计费峰值或弹性带宽应对。
✅ 3. 是否使用CDN、对象存储、负载均衡等中间层
- ✅ 正确架构下,云服务器仅承担回源流量或动态计算,带宽可大幅降低(常降至10–30%)。
- ❌ 若未用CDN直接暴露源站,小流量攻击(如CC)即可打满带宽,造成雪崩。
✅ 4. 安全防护与异常流量
- DDoS攻击、爬虫、恶意扫描会消耗大量带宽。建议:
• 基础防护:云厂商免费DDoS基础防护(如阿里云5Gbps);
• 进阶防护:开启WAF + 高防IP(尤其X_X/政企类业务);
• 监控告警:设置带宽使用率>80%自动告警,识别异常突增。
| ✅ 5. 计费模式与成本控制 | 计费方式 | 适用场景 | 注意事项 |
|---|---|---|---|
| 固定带宽 | 流量稳定、可预测(如企业内部系统) | 超配浪费,不足需重启调整 | |
| 按流量计费 | 流量波动大、有明显低谷(如博客、测试环境) | 防止突发流量产生天价账单(建议设用量告警+月度上限) | |
| 增强型95计费(主流推荐) | 中大型生产环境(如官网、APP后端) | 取当月每5分钟峰值的前5%剔除,按剩余最高值计费,兼顾弹性与成本 |
✅ 6. 其他隐性因素
- 操作系统及应用开销:Linux内核协议栈、SSL/TLS加密(HTTPS比HTTP多10–20% CPU和少量带宽开销);
- 备份与同步流量:跨可用区/跨地域数据库同步、日志上传至OSS/S3,需单独规划带宽(建议走内网或夜间错峰);
- 监控与日志采集:Prometheus远程写入、ELK日志上报,通常较小但不可忽略。
二、实操建议:如何科学选带宽?
🔹 Step 1:基线测量(强烈推荐!)
- 新业务上线前,用压测工具(如JMeter、k6)模拟真实用户行为,监控服务器
iftop/nethogs/云监控中的出网带宽(eth0 OUT); - 观察高峰期(如促销、发布后2小时)的持续15分钟平均带宽,而非瞬时峰值。
🔹 Step 2:留足弹性冗余
- 一般业务:1.5–2倍基线值(应对增长与波动);
- 高可用要求:3倍基线 + CDN兜底;
- 切忌“刚好够用”——带宽打满会导致TCP重传、连接超时、用户体验断崖式下降。
🔹 Step 3:优先架构优化,再扩容带宽
✔️ 启用Gzip/Brotli压缩(HTML/JS/CSS减小60–80%)
✔️ 合理设置HTTP缓存头(Cache-Control, ETag)
✔️ 图片懒加载 + WebP格式 + 自适应分辨率
✔️ 静态资源全部托管至OSS/CDN,源站仅处理动态逻辑
🔹 Step 4:持续监控与迭代
- 设置云监控告警:带宽使用率 > 70%(持续5分钟)、错误率 > 0.1%;
- 每季度复盘:流量趋势、用户增长、CDN缓存命中率(目标>95%);
- 利用云厂商「带宽智能调度」或「弹性公网IP」实现按需升降配(部分厂商支持不重启变更)。
📌 总结一句话:
“够用”的带宽 = (实测业务峰值 × 冗余系数) − (CDN/缓存/压缩节省的流量) + (安全防护与运维预留)
永远优先通过架构优化降带宽需求,而非盲目买大带宽——省钱、提效、更健壮。
需要我帮你:
🔸 根据你的具体业务(如:WordPress博客/小程序后端/在线教育直播)做带宽估算?
🔸 对比阿里云/腾讯云/华为云的带宽计费细节?
🔸 提供一份《云服务器带宽监控与告警配置清单》?
欢迎补充信息,我来定制化分析 👇
云计算